FAIREST ISLE
3.00 Mining the Archive In the last of four programmes from the Aldeburgh Festival, Susan Sharpe presents part of a concert given in June 1978 featuring the first performance of Thel by Gordon Crosse and the Lyric Triptych by Krzysztof Meyer.
Peter Pears (tenor)
Contrapuncti, conductor Michael Lankster
Series producer Anthony Sellors

FAIREST ISLE
4.30 Lyrae Cambrenses Gwyn L Williams presents the first of three programmes on the traditional music of Wales.
This week, the crwth, the pibgorn and witches' feet. Producer Gwyn L Williams
